According to the Barside Buzz, Spider-Man 4 will have a new supporting cast, which could mean no Jacob Batalon as Ned. The rumor comes from Daniel RPK on Patreon. Daniel, despite what some outlets published, does not say Ned is definitely not in the film. What he did say he has heard is that Spider-Man 4 will feature a new supporting cast. The film is said to be a fresh take on the character under new director Destin Daniel Cretton. Some fans and outlets are therefore assuming this means Jacob Batalon may not return as Ned.
This story, if true, actually makes perfect sense. No one remembers Peter Parker. He’s got no family left and no friends. He’s likely starting again away from High School and in College. Therefore, I do agree it could be possible there is no Ned in the film. I just won’t declare he’s out based on this alone.

Now, one name not being mentioned by anyone as part of that previous supporting cast is Zendaya. It may be slightly tricky for Marvel to get Tom Holland to agree to replace his fiancé. Yet, insider Jeff Sneider keeps insisting there’s a huge scheduling problem for Zendaya to appear in Spider-Man 4.
My guess, (again, IF this rumor checks out) is that Zendaya will appear. However, given she doesn’t know Peter, I wonder if it will just be a few small scenes. Like, perhaps Peter watching her from afar? In that way Spider-Man 4 could introduce a new supporting cast without completely abandoning the old cast. Meaning Marvel can bring them back for inevitable Spider-Man 5 if that’s the eventual plan.
